Product Description
Rorippa nasturtium aquaticum, commonly known as our native Watercress, is an edible plant that should only be consumed if grown in clean water. However, it's just as enjoyable when left in your pond to add beauty to your water garden. Its dark green foliage gracefully spills over hollow, rafting stems across the surface of the water. From May to July, small white flowers bloom in dense clusters at the tips of the stems. Watercress is a fantastic marginal aquatic plant that provides valuable shelter for wildlife. Height: 60cm (24). Spread: 100cm (39). Planting depth: Zones 1 and 2, up to 10cm (4) below water level.
